Step-by-Step Overview to Fence Setup



As soon as you've determined to move on with your fencing installation, complying with a structured step-by-step strategy will certainly guarantee a smooth procedure. Start by noting the fence line with risks and string to visualize the format. Next, examine local laws to verify conformity with elevation and building lines.


Dig article openings a minimum of two feet deep, spaced according to your fencing type-- commonly 6 to 8 feet apart. Put the messages right into the openings and load them with concrete for stability. Once the articles are established, attach the horizontal rails or panels, making certain they're level.


Safeguard the panels or pickets, confirming they straighten appropriately. If you're making use of gateways, mount them last, ensuring they swing openly. Check for any type of loose links and make necessary adjustments. Your fence should currently be ready to enhance your building and provide the personal privacy or safety you need!

Normal Cleaning Schedule



While it may be simple to ignore, establishing a routine cleaning schedule is crucial for preserving the longevity their website of your fence. Start by rinsing your fencing with water a minimum of as soon as every season to remove dust and particles. For wood fencings, make use of a gentle soap solution and a soft brush to scrub away any mold and mildew or mildew. Do not forget to look for any corrosion on metal fencings; a cable brush can assist remove it, complied with by a layer of rust-resistant paint. If you reside in an area with hefty pollen or dust, you might wish to boost your cleansing frequency. Keeping your fencing tidy not only improves its appearance but also extends its life, conserving you money in the future.

Apply Safety Coatings



After checking your fencing for damage, applying safety coverings is a crucial action in guaranteeing its durability. Depending on the material, you'll wish to pick the appropriate kind of finishing. For wood fences, a premium sealer or wood tarnish can protect against moisture absorption and discourage bugs. If your fencing is vinyl or metal, think about a UV-protective spray or paint to avoid fading and rust.


Ensure to cleanse the surface area thoroughly prior to application, as dust and gunk can undermine the finishing's effectiveness. Use the coating in dry weather condition for much better adhesion, and do not forget to comply with the producer's guidelines for the very best outcomes. On a regular basis reapply every couple of years to maintain your fencing looking excellent and standing solid versus the elements.

Can I Install a Fence on an Incline?



Yes, you can set up a fencing on a slope. You'll need to adjust your installment technique, either by tipping the panels down or using a racked style to guarantee stability and correct positioning with the surface.
